1. A wet granulator, comprising a material cylinder; wherein, a cylinder cover is rotatably arranged at an opening of the material cylinder, and a locking member is arranged on the cylinder cover; the locking member comprises a locking housing, and the locking housing is provided with a first through groove; a locking pin slides in the first through groove, and the locking pin comprises a middle rod and a contacting rod; a first end of the contacting rod is connected to a first end of the middle rod to form a contacting platform, and a second end of the contacting rod extends out of the first through groove; the first end of the middle rod is arranged in the first through groove, and a second end of the middle rod extends out of the first through groove; the second end of the middle rod is provided with a pin head, and a diameter of the pin head is larger than a diameter of the first through groove;
a reset spring is sleeved on the middle rod; a contacting step is arranged inside the first through groove; a first end of the reset spring is fixedly installed on the contacting step, and a second end of the reset spring is arranged in contact with the contacting platform to form a linkage between the locking pin and the reset spring; a force caused by a weight of the locking pin is less than a reset elastic force of the reset spring to fix the locking pin on the first through groove; and
a contacting block is arranged at the opening of the material cylinder, and the contacting block is provided with a continuous slope surface; the continuous slope surface is arranged toward a movement direction of the locking member, and the locking pin is arranged in alignment with the continuous slope surface; the locking member rotates to contact the contacting block and drives the locking pin to slide in the first through groove.
